Last month, the Calgary-based transport truck driver,Jaskirat Singh Sidhu,was sentenced to eight years in prison after pleading guiltyin January to 29 counts of dangerous driving causing death or bodily harm. Histruck was completely blocking the intersection when the Broncos bus slammed into the leadtrailer at just before 5 p.m. Tire marks show the bus tried to stop, but the truck did not. One of Canada's most high-profile highway tragedies occurred on 6 April 2018, when a bus carrying 28 members of the Humboldt Broncos junior hockey team collided with a transport truck at a highway intersection near Tisdale, Saskatchewan.
